The Christian Biblical Phrase Which is Used During the Sermon On the Mount Speech and the Meaning of the Christian Phrase “Sufficient Unto the Day is the Evil Thereof”

The Biblical phrase ”sufficient unto the day is the evil thereof" is an aphorism which appears in the Sermon on the Mount in the Gospel of Matthew. This proverb implies that one should not worry about the future, as each day contains ample burden of evils and suffering...
